Я полагаю, что правильный формат:
@users - priority 10
username - priority 19
Это - пример настроек, которые я использую в производстве (очевидно, с настоящими пользователями/группами).
nice
установка должна определить минимальное хорошее значение (т.е. максимальный приоритет), кто-то может установить их процесс на, не их приоритет по умолчанию.
Перевод так или иначе @polynomial отвечает на bash
:
#!/bin/bash
if [[ ! -e textfile2 ]]; then
mkfifo textfile2
fi
while true; do
(
exec >textfile2
cat textfile2-header
cat textfile1
cat textfile2-footer
)
done
Вы могли сделать это с именованными каналами. В основном Вы поддержали бы свои текстовые файлы где-нибудь как 'шаблоны' и сценарий как этот пример жемчуга:
http://perl.active-venture.com/pod/perlipc-pipes.html
Открыл бы 'textfile3' как канал и когда это добралось, чтение запрашивают, чтобы он вывел бы содержание, которое textfile3 должен содержать (возможно, путем чтения textfile3.template и замены содержания по мере необходимости). Это позволило бы Вам динамично изменять содержание, не имея необходимость обновлять несколько файлов и с минимальной конфигурацией.